搜索

怎样用Excel自动计算司龄

发布网友 发布时间:2024-10-24 17:06

我来回答

1个回答

热心网友 时间:2024-10-24 19:04

在Excel中自动计算司龄,可以通过结合日期函数来实现,无需复杂的表格或图片说明。假设入职日期存储在A列(例如A2单元格为某员工的入职日期),可以在B列(例如B2单元格)输入公式来计算司龄。

一种常用的方法是使用`DATEDIF`函数,该函数可以直接计算两个日期之间的年、月、日差。若要计算司龄(以年为单位,忽略月份和天数),可以在B2单元格输入以下公式:

```excel
=DATEDIF(A2, TODAY(), "Y")
```

这里,`A2`是员工的入职日期,`TODAY()`函数返回当前日期,`"Y"`指定返回两个日期之间的整年数。

请注意,`DATEDIF`函数不是Excel的官方文档函数,但在所有版本的Excel中广泛支持和使用。它特别适用于此类日期差异计算。

如果希望同时显示完整的年月日司龄(例如2年3个月),可以使用更复杂的嵌套`DATEDIF`和`INT`、`MOD`等函数组合,但基本思路相同,都是基于日期差异计算。

最后,将B2单元格中的公式向下拖动或复制,即可为整列或整表中的所有员工自动计算司龄。
声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。
E-MAIL:11247931@qq.com
Top